Your browser has Javascript disabled. … WebScratching is normal cat behavior; it helps your cat stretch their muscles, shed the outer nail sheath from their claws and mark territory. In the wild, cats use their claws to catch prey, defend themselves and escape from predators. At home, that translates to attacking toys and climbing to favorite perches.

WebScratching is a normal feline behavior. Although scratching does serve to shorten and condition the claws, perhaps the most important reason cats scratch is to mark their territory (both visibly and with the scent of the foot pads).
